Business
Baillie Gifford US Growth Trust PLC is a UK-listed closed-end investment trust that seeks long-term capital growth by investing predominantly in equities of high-growth companies incorporated, domiciled, or conducting significant business in the United States; the portfolio comprises up to 90 direct holdings in listed and unlisted securities, typically 30 or more listed holdings, with a maximum of 50% in private companies; key sectors include information technology, consumer discretionary, industrials, and communication services, featuring top positions such as Space Exploration Technologies, Stripe, Shopify, Amazon.com, NVIDIA, Cloudflare, Meta Platforms, Netflix, DoorDash, and Databricks. The Trust, launched in 2018 and headquartered in Edinburgh, Scotland, benchmarks against the S&P 500 Index and is managed by Baillie Gifford & Co Limited as its alternative investment fund manager, with co-managers Gary Robinson and Kirsty Gibson emphasizing bottom-up growth investing in exceptional companies across public and private markets. Recent portfolio changes include new private company investments in Rippling (workforce management), Runway AI (generative AI video platform), and Cosm (immersive entertainment), alongside listed additions such as DraftKings, Globant, Lineage, SharkNinja, and The Ensign Group; sales encompassed 10X Genomics, Coursera, HashiCorp, Sprout Social, and others amid low turnover of 9.1%, reflecting a long-term horizon; as of May 2025, private holdings represent 34.9% of assets across 27 companies, while Saba Capital Management increased its stake above 30%, prompting board discussions on shareholder-aligned strategies; the Annual General Meeting occurs on 2 October 2025 in Edinburgh, with ongoing share issuance and buyback authorities in place.
